About Cris

Cris A. Rasco is a attorney based in Texas City, Texas, with over 36 years of experience in personal injury law. He earned his Juris Doctor from St. Mary's University in San Antonio in 1989. Prior to his legal career, Mr. Rasco obtained a Bachelor of Science in Building Construction from Texas A&M University in 1980. After law school, Mr. Rasco returned to the Dallas/Fort Worth area, establishing a private practice that focused on personal injury, medical malpractice, construction law, general civil litigation, and mass torts.

His dedication and expertise led to jury awards and settlements amounting to tens of millions of dollars for his clients. Recognized for his tenacious litigation style, he earned a reputation among judges and peers as a advocate. In 2003, seeking a change of environment, Mr. Rasco relocated to Galveston. He served as Assistant City Attorney for the City of Galveston, where he authored several city ordinances pivotal to the city's revitalization efforts. He also acted as the city's lead counsel in various litigation matters and was chief counsel to two separate city charter review committees. During his tenure, he collaborated closely with entities such as the Texas General Land Office and the National Park Service on regulatory issues concerning the public beach and dune system. In 2006, Mr.

Rasco returned to private practice while continuing to consult for the City of Galveston on several issues. He developed real estate on Galveston Island and drafted several development agreements between the city and local subdivisions. His work included negotiating reimbursement agreements with the city and assisting with regulatory requirements to acquire demolition and building permits. Currently, Mr. Rasco represents a diverse range of clients, including condominium and homeowners associations, providing comprehensive legal services such as corporate governance, governing document revisions, collections, storm damage reconstruction, and litigation. He also handles family law cases, including divorce and child custody matters, emphasizing timely and result-oriented solutions. Mr. Rasco is admitted to practice in Texas and before several federal courts, including the U.S.
